Given Input numbers are 643, 675, 74, 909
To find the GCD of numbers using factoring list out all the divisors of each number
Divisors of 643
List of positive integer divisors of 643 that divides 643 without a remainder.
1, 643
Divisors of 675
List of positive integer divisors of 675 that divides 675 without a remainder.
1, 3, 5, 9, 15, 25, 27, 45, 75, 135, 225, 675
Divisors of 74
List of positive integer divisors of 74 that divides 74 without a remainder.
1, 2, 37, 74
Divisors of 909
List of positive integer divisors of 909 that divides 909 without a remainder.
1, 3, 9, 101, 303, 909
Greatest Common Divisior
We found the divisors of 643, 675, 74, 909 . The biggest common divisior number is the GCD number.
So the Greatest Common Divisior 643, 675, 74, 909 is 1.
Therefore, GCD of numbers 643, 675, 74, 909 is 1
Given Input Data is 643, 675, 74, 909
Make a list of Prime Factors of all the given numbers initially
Prime Factorization of 643 is 643
Prime Factorization of 675 is 3 x 3 x 3 x 5 x 5
Prime Factorization of 74 is 2 x 37
Prime Factorization of 909 is 3 x 3 x 101
The above numbers do not have any common prime factor. So GCD is 1
